Tinder: Swiping Your Way to Success
Tinder, a name synonymous with mobile dating, remains a dominant force. Its core mechanic—the simple swipe left or right—is both intuitive and addictive. This ease of use contributes significantly to its massive user base. However, Tinder’s popularity also means a higher level of competition. You’ll find a wide variety of users, from casual daters to those seeking long-term relationships.
Pros: Massive user base, simple interface, quick matching process.Cons: Can feel superficial, many inactive profiles, potentially overwhelming number of matches.
For example, Tinder’s Passport feature allows you to connect with people in different locations, ideal for travelers or those looking for a wider dating pool. However, the free version’s limitations, such as restricted swipes, can be frustrating for some users.
Bumble: Women Take the Lead
Bumble flips the traditional dating app script. Only women can initiate conversations, empowering them to control the pace and direction of interactions. This unique feature attracts a user base that values respect and agency. While Bumble’s user base is smaller than Tinder’s, it boasts a more engaged and focused community.
Pros: Empowering for women, higher quality interactions, strong focus on relationships.Cons: Smaller user base compared to Tinder, slower matching process.
Bumble’s BFF feature, designed for platonic friendships, is a notable addition, showcasing the app’s broader social ambitions beyond romantic connections. The app’s in-app payment system allows for seamless upgrades to premium features.
Hinge: Designed for Meaningful Connections
Hinge distinguishes itself by prioritizing meaningful connections over superficial swiping. The app encourages users to create detailed profiles, highlighting their interests and personalities. This approach leads to more thoughtful interactions and a higher chance of finding compatible partners. Hinge’s algorithm focuses on compatibility, suggesting matches based on shared interests and values.
Pros: Focus on meaningful connections, detailed profiles, sophisticated matching algorithm.Cons: Smaller user base than Tinder or Bumble, requires more effort to create a profile.
Hinge’s prompts, which encourage users to answer engaging questions about themselves, are a key differentiator. These prompts provide valuable insights into potential matches, facilitating more substantial conversations.
Feature Comparison
Feature | Tinder | Bumble | Hinge |
---|---|---|---|
User Base | Very Large | Large | Medium |
Matching System | Swipe-based | Swipe-based, women initiate | Algorithm-based, detailed profiles |
Focus | Casual to serious | Relationships, friendships | Meaningful connections |
Cost | Free (with paid options) | Free (with paid options) | Free (with paid options) |

Matching Algorithms and Priorities
Dating apps employ various matching algorithms,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Some prioritize shared interests and values, while others focus on physical attraction. Understanding how an app’s algorithm works is crucial for optimizing your experience. For instance, OkCupid is known for its detailed questionnaires and compatibility matching, making it a good choice for those seeking meaningful connections based on shared values. Conversely, apps like Tinder rely more on swiping and visual appeal. Align your app choice with your priorities—whether it’s shared interests, physical attraction, or a combination of both.
Safety and Privacy First
Safety and privacy are paramount when using dating apps. Look for apps with robust security features, such as background checks, reporting mechanisms, and clear privacy policies. Features like photo verification and two-factor authentication can significantly enhance your safety. Always be cautious about sharing personal information and meet in public places for initial dates. Many apps, including Bumble, offer safety features like emergency contact options and the ability to share your location with trusted friends.
